				<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p><strong>Yahoo has redesigned its Flickr photo-sharing service, offering users up to 1TB of storage for free.</strong></p>
<p>The long-overdue revamp includes a new interface based around higher-resolution pictures and a new app has also been launched for Android devices.</p>
<p>Yahoo purchased Flickr in 2005 as the site became increasingly popular, but failed to keep up with rivals such as Facebook and Pinterest.</p>
<p>Flickr’s tagline used to be “almost certainly the best online photo management and sharing application in the world”, but the humble brag has not been true for years as sharing photos online has become dominated by social networking, while the need to store photographs has decreased thanks to cloud storage services.</p>
<p>Likewise, Flickr failed to capitalise on the mobile market with its basic app for iPhones out-performed by products such as Instagram.</p>
<p><img class="aligncenter size-full wp-image-994" alt="New Flickr layout" src="http://www.riverside-design.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2013/05/8758381413_c3db9198c7_z.jpg" width="560" height="430" /></p>
<p>But the new-look site should entice users back to the service and it&#8217;s ability to host large images in full resolution is a big advantage over the likes of Facebook, where they are compressed.</p>
<p>Key features include:</p>
<ul>
<li>1TB upload limit &#8211; enough to store more than half a million six-megapixel photos</li>
<li>Redesigned user-interface that fills more of the page with pictures at the expense of white space</li>
<li>New Activity Feed allowing users to see their own recent uploads mixed together with those of their friends</li>
<li>New Android app offering a more photo-centric design than the previous version, bringing it closer in line to an iOS update released at the end of last year</li>
<li>Larger 200MB limit on the size of each photo &#8211; previously, paid-for accounts had a 50MB limit and free accounts 30MB</li>
<li>Three-minute cap on playback of video clips rather than the earlier limit of 90 seconds</li>
</ul>
<p>Flickr currently has more than 90 million monthly active users, but just as importantly, the service has been reinvigorated.</p>
<p>Its mobile-first approach has made it relevant again, while that terabyte of storage is an attractive proposition for any keen photographer.</p>

				<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p><strong>Business networking site LinkedIn has announced a long overdue redesign with a cleaner, simpler and more dynamic homepage.</strong></p>
<p>In <a href="http://blog.linkedin.com/2012/07/16/introducing-a-simpler-homepage/" rel="nofollow" target="_blank">a blog post</a>, LinkedIn product manager Caroline Gaffney said that the redesign will offer &#8220;quick access to the relevant information and updates&#8221; that help users of the site &#8220;be great at their job&#8221;.</p>
<p>The new look brings a simpler and more modern design to the homepage experience, improving navigation between the pages and the updates &#8211; whether that may be shared news stories from key contacts or updates on people who have changed jobs.</p>
<p>The most important network updates and articles are now flagged at the top of the feed, highlighting trending topics, news stories and professional updates based on what is being followed and discussed.</p>
<p><img class="aligncenter size-full wp-image-885" title="LinkedIn redesign" src="http://www.riverside-design.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2012/07/linkedin.jpg" alt="" width="560" height="617" /></p>
<p>The stream is more social than before with the ability to like, comment on and share update items. A one-click “Connect” button makes it easier to add users who appear in your update stream to your list of contacts.</p>
<p>Additionally, the sidebar widget features useful information such as the number of visitors to your profile in the past 90 days. This is a great way to measure the effectiveness of your LinkedIn page.</p>
<p>The popular social network, which is said to have over 160 million users, has been increasingly focused on bringing more content to its platform.</p>
<p>&#8220;We look forward to making the LinkedIn homepage your go-to destination to discover and discuss what matters to you, your industry and your professionals network.&#8221;</p>
<p>The new design is set to roll out to users over the next few weeks and will be followed by some new features for improved functionality and customisation, perhaps enticing some users back after their unfortunate security breach last month.</p>

				<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p><strong>The Internet is going to get a whole lot bigger in 2013 with the release of hundreds of new domain name extensions.</strong></p>
<p>ICANN (Internet Corporation for Assigned Domains and Numbers), the body responsible for managing and coordinating the Internet’s Domain Name System, has begun the process to introduce new gTLDs (generic Top Level Domains) in order to increase competition and consumer choice for new domain name extensions online.</p>
<p>Today there are just a few gTLDs available, for example: .com, .net, .org, .biz, and .info. But from next year you will be able to purchase city-based domains such as .london and .paris, industry sectors such as .cars and .music and even web slang like .lol.</p>
<p>A study by Sedo, the Internet domain name marketplace and monetization provider, revealed that the most sought after domain extension is .shop.</p>
<p>Sedo’s research was based on the nearly 2,000 applications ICANN has received from organisations seeking new domain extensions that will join the existing suffixes.</p>
<p>Some of those were from companies wishing to run their own custom domain based on their name, for example: .google, .nike and .coca-cola, and some from domain registrars that are purchasing them on behalf of others or are looking to profit by selling them off.</p>
<p>The limiting factor in generating new domain name endings is the cost involved. The one-time application fee is $185,000, and annual charges are, at a minimum, $75,000 per each ending. Nevertheless, for big corporations, these fees represent insignificant monetary levels.</p>
<p>Two or more applicants can’t be granted the same top-level domain name, which makes certain extensions more desirable than others. And with nearly 40 percent of all submissions having more than one applicant, there are going to be battles over the “.app” and “.blog” type of domain extensions.</p>
<p>It may be expensive, bu there are many positives to the new scheme. Better innovation, the increase in brand visibility, and a clearer and more targeted domain for brands will help lead the charge for the ever expanding Internet, and it’s future.</p>

				<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p><strong>Google’s Chrome is now the most popular Web browser worldwide, surpassing Microsoft’s Internet Explorer for the first time, according to the latest figures from StatCounter. </strong></p>
<p>After years of slowly chipping away Internet Explorer’s market share, Chrome took the lead with 32.76 percent, while IE dipped to 31.94 percent.</p>
<p>Just a year ago, Internet Explorer was leading the Web browser market share with 43 percent, followed by Mozilla Firefox with 29 percent, and Chrome was third with 19 percent.</p>
<p>Twelve months later, IE has lost 12 percent of the browser market share while Chrome gained 13 percent to the detriment of IE and Firefox, which also lost about 4 percent of its users and now comes in at just over 25 percent.</p>
<p><img class="aligncenter size-full wp-image-865" title="Browser usage chart May 2012" src="http://www.riverside-design.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2012/05/browser-chart.jpg" alt="" width="560" height="315" /></p>
<p>This is not the first time Chrome has leapfrogged Internet Explorer. For a single day in March, Chrome was estimated to have held a few percentage decimals over IE. This time however, Chrome overtook IE for the entire week, though by still less than a percentage point.</p>
<p>Although the difference is minimal, Chrome has been on an upward trend for quite some time, due to its simple user interface and improved loading speed compared to its rivals.</p>
<p>However IE still is the default web browser for Windows machines and with the launch of Windows 8 and Internet Explorer 10 later this year, it throws up the question whether Windows tablets will limit third-party browser functionality.</p>
